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
The candidate must be proficient on the computer, self motivated and able to excel in time sensitive situations. The ideal person for this job will be comfortable working in a demanding, fast paced and intense environment at times.
Routers will be utilizing specified software (RoadNet, Descartes Route Planner) to route deliveries by matching customer orders to appropriate loads assigned to trucks. Routers must efficiently route in a way that maximizes cube space on trailer while optimizing routes to reduce total amount of miles traveled.
Assigning drivers to routes (and making adjustments as needed per CBA/Union Contract). Communicating to drivers; routes and changes.
Work closely with Sales and Warehouse Departments to determine delivery feasibility. Build cost effective routes while maintaining customer needs.
Analyze / Prepare various reports on a daily basis, i.e. route changes request, sequence change requests, new customer request, etc.
